Top 5 Food and Diet Tracking Apps on iOS in Uruguay for Q3 2023
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 food and diet tracking apps on iOS in Uruguay during the third quarter of 2023, based on data from Sensor Tower.
During the third quarter of 2023, the top 5 food and diet tracking apps on iOS in Uruguay showed varied performance trends in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a closer look at each app's performance:
Fastin: Intermittent Fasting from Bongmi Global Group saw a significant peak in weekly downloads, reaching 394 in mid-August. The app's weekly revenue experienced a steady rise, peaking at approximately $405 in early August. Active users fluctuated, peaking at around 3.6K in mid-August and ending the quarter at 3.5K.
Kompanion Intermittent Fasting from Alivex showed a notable increase in weekly downloads in late July, reaching 320. Weekly revenue also saw a peak of about $480 in mid-August. Active users increased steadily, peaking at 651 in mid-September before slightly declining to 501 by the end of the quarter.
MyFitnessPal: Calorie Counter from MyFitnessPal, Inc. had a peak in weekly revenue of around $416 in early August. Downloads were consistent, with a notable peak of 143 in mid-August. Active users peaked at nearly 4K in mid-September and maintained a stable user base around 3.6K by the end of the quarter.
Fastic: Food & Calorie Tracker from HealthVida GmbH & Co. KG witnessed a peak in weekly downloads of 223 in late September. Weekly revenue remained relatively stable, peaking at $296 in late August. Active users saw a steady increase, peaking at 626 in late September.
Fitia: Diet & Meal Planner from Nutrition Technologies experienced a peak in weekly downloads of 227 at the start of the quarter. The app's weekly revenue saw a peak of about $292 in late August. Active users fluctuated throughout the quarter, ending with 903 in late September.
